Alvin Detert
ST. IGNATIUS - Alvin Detert, 86, passed away Friday, Sept. 13, 2002, in Missoula.

Born in Ceylon, Minn., on May 6, 1916, to Ben and Anna (Saggau) Detert, he moved with his family to Montana at a young age. After receiving his education, Alvin joined the Army Air Corps. He served in China and was involved in flying the hump in Burma. After his military service, he made his home in several places before returning to the Mission Valley where he helped farm.

Alvin was preceded in death by his parents, sister Verna Lensman and brother Harvey Detert.

A very private man, Alvin never married but will be greatly missed by his family. He leaves behind his brother Herman and sister Marie as well as many nieces, nephews and cousins.

A private family service will be held Wednesday.

The Missoulian Newspaper, Sept. 16, 2002.
